Coverage limits are clearly defined in your contract, so you always know what to expect. The warranty provider will cover repairs up to the specified limit, and you are responsible for any costs above that amount.

Many home warranty plans also offer optional add-ons for items that are not included in the standard coverage. These may include pool and spa equipment, well pumps, septic systems, and additional refrigerators or freezers.
Home warranty coverage is designed to handle the most common and expensive home repairs. The average cost of an HVAC replacement is $5,000 to $10,000, while a water heater replacement can cost $1,000 to $3,000. With a home warranty, you pay only a small service fee.

Most home warranty plans near First United Bank and Trust Company in Oklahoma City have a 30-day waiting period. This means your coverage begins 30 days after you enroll. After the waiting period, you can file claims for any covered breakdowns.
